What is the main difference between OPGW (Optical Ground Wire) and traditional ground wire?

2025-08-12
Professional Answer: The primary difference is that OPGW is a dual-purpose cable, combining the function of a traditional ground wire with an integrated optical fiber communication channel. While a traditional ground wire only provides lightning protection and a path for fault currents, OPGW offers these same critical safety functions while also enabling high-speed, reliable data transmission. This allows utility companies to establish communication networks for real-time monitoring and control of the power grid, optimizing performance and enhancing reliability.
